Severnlea is a locality 175 km from Brisbane in Queensland, classified as outer regional by the ABS. The postcode is 4352. It falls within the Toowoomba region. The local government area is Southern Downs.

According to the 2021 Census, Severnlea has a population of 382 with a median age of 46. The median weekly household income is $1,164, below the QLD average. The unemployment rate is 1.7%, lower than the QLD average. The Indigenous population is 7 (1.8% of residents).

Housing in Severnlea includes a median weekly rent of $200, median monthly mortgage repayment of $1,311, with 137 total dwellings. Housing costs in the area sit below the QLD average. Owner-occupied dwellings (owned or mortgaged) make up 85.6% of housing.

On the SEIFA Index of Relative Socio-economic Advantage and Disadvantage, Severnlea scores in decile 5 out of 10, which is around the national average.

Severnlea is served by Severnlea State School.
